The Process

I've been a learning professional for over ten years, so I thought writing this course would be easy. I had it all mapped out in my head and a nifty project plan to go along with it. I estimated 30-days to write the course, 7-days to record, 7-days to edit, and then the course would be up and running. But, it didn't quite work that way.

It did take about 30-days to write the course, but I quickly realized that even though I'm well-versed in training, I didn't know the process for the online platform that I was writing the course for, which changed the game. So, I spent the next 30-days taking a class on the best way to write, market and sell a course specific to the platform. It was an eye-opening experience. I had to do a slight rewrite, but the end result was a much better product. 

The other thing that I did not take into account was the submission process for the course, which was more extensive than I originally anticipated. The upside is that I now know what to expect from the process, and I have a better system for completing the work. It all comes back to not only having a system but one that works efficiently. ​

Perseverance & Persistence

In the latter part of the process, I started to feel weighed down and antsy, because it felt like things were moving too slow. I ran across this passage that kept me encouraged. It says:
With perseverance and persistence, I create an exceptional life.
I always thought the words perseverance and persistence meant the same thing. I wanted to understand what the author of the quote meant, so in typical Latarsha fashion, I looked for definitions. Here are two definitions that I found: 
  • Perseverance is "persistence in doing something despite difficulty or delay in achieving success."
  • Persistence is a "firm or obstinate continuance in a course of action in spite of difficulty or opposition."
I experienced many delays and what felt like difficulties as I created this course. But when I look back, I learned from them. So, were these really delays or just short stops along the journey to better learn the process?

I was also determined to finish the course, no matter what. I don't mind changing directions when it makes sense. That's normal for me. What I don't succumb to is giving up. Seeing things through matter. It's how you honor your word.

So, as I developed a course on "how to master your emotions," I found yet another way to master my own. I love that about life. As long as you're open to being a student, it is your forever teacher.
